首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Swifty JSON:将JSON数组中的分层对象列表转换为分层Swift对象

Swifty JSON是一种用于将JSON数组中的分层对象列表转换为分层Swift对象的工具。它提供了简单易用的方法,使开发人员能够轻松地将JSON数据解析为可操作的Swift对象。

Swifty JSON的主要优势包括:

  1. 简化JSON解析过程:Swifty JSON提供了简洁的语法和方法,使得解析JSON数据变得非常简单和直观。开发人员可以使用点语法和下标操作符来访问和操作JSON数据,无需手动解析和转换数据类型。
  2. 快速高效:Swifty JSON使用底层的解析技术和优化算法,以提供快速和高效的JSON解析性能。它能够处理大型的JSON数据,并且具有较低的内存消耗。
  3. 强大的功能:Swifty JSON支持各种数据类型,包括字符串、数字、布尔值、数组和嵌套对象。开发人员可以轻松地访问和修改JSON数据的各个层级,以满足复杂的业务需求。
  4. 跨平台支持:Swifty JSON可以在各种平台上使用,包括iOS、macOS、watchOS和tvOS。它与Swift语言无缝集成,并且可以与其他Swift框架和库一起使用。

Swifty JSON适用于许多应用场景,包括但不限于:

  1. 网络数据请求和响应处理:当与后端API进行通信时,通常会使用JSON格式的数据进行数据传输。Swifty JSON可以帮助开发人员轻松地解析和处理从服务器返回的JSON数据。
  2. 数据持久化和存储:如果应用程序需要将数据存储到本地文件或数据库中,Swifty JSON可以帮助开发人员将JSON数据转换为Swift对象,并进行存储和读取操作。
  3. 前端开发:在前端开发中,经常需要使用JSON数据来渲染用户界面。Swifty JSON可以帮助开发人员轻松地将JSON数据解析为可用于UI渲染的Swift对象。

推荐的腾讯云相关产品和产品介绍链接地址如下:

  1. 腾讯云云服务器(CVM):提供高性能的云服务器实例,可用于部署和运行应用程序。详情请访问:https://cloud.tencent.com/product/cvm
  2. 腾讯云对象存储(COS):提供可靠、安全和高扩展性的对象存储服务,用于存储和管理大规模的非结构化数据。详情请访问:https://cloud.tencent.com/product/cos
  3. 腾讯云云数据库MySQL版(TencentDB for MySQL):提供可扩展和易管理的云数据库服务,适用于各种应用程序的数据存储需求。详情请访问:https://cloud.tencent.com/product/cdb_mysql

请注意,以上链接仅为示例,具体的产品选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券